S9Y Serendipity Remote RSS sidebar Plugin Cross Site Scripting Vulnerability

S9Y Serendipity Remote RSS sidebar plugin is prone to a cross-site scripting vulnerability because it fails to sufficiently sanitize user-supplied data.

Exploiting this issue allows an attacker to execute arbitrary HTML or script code in a user's browser session in the context of an affected site. This may allow the attacker to steal cookie-based authentication credentials and launch other attacks.

This issue affects versions prior to S9Y Serendipity 1.2.1.

Exploit / POC

S9Y Serendipity Remote RSS sidebar Plugin Cross Site Scripting Vulnerability

An attacker can exploit this issue by constructing a malicious RSS feed that is embedded into a blog and displayed to users.
